To assist you in seeing some of the education options that are available to you, Course Advisor has created its Best Value Dietetics & Nutrition Services Bachelor's Degree Schools in Oklahoma ranking.

Our ranking of value is based on the quality of a program as defined in our per sticker price dollar. More specifically, we discount our quality score by the published tuition and fees charged by a school.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The value is determined by how much quality your dollar buys.

In our regional and nationwide rankings, out-of-state tution and fees are used in our calculations. Average in-state tuition and fees are used for our statewide rankings.

Best Dietetics & Clinical Nutrition Services Bachelor's Degree School

Our analysis found Northeastern State University to be the best value school for dietetics and clinical nutrition services students who want to pursue a bachelor’s degree in Oklahoma. NSU is a medium-sized public school located in the town of Tahlequah.

In-state tuition fees for undergraduate students at NSU are $7,115 per year. After completing their Bachelor's Degree, nutrition graduates from NSU carry an average student debtload of $27,296.
